Back to Workflows
automationintermediate

Clean‑Enough Signals Coach for Branch Decisions

A chat-based decision coach that helps leaders pressure-test branch numbers, spot dirty signal early, and choose when automation is safe vs when judgment is required.

Calypso
2 integrations

Integrations

WhatsAppCalypso Knowledge Base

Tags

decision-systemssignal-designbranch-performancedata-qualityattributionleadership

Workflow Visualization

Rendered directly from the published workflow JSON.

33 nodes43 connections
CWorkflow settingsFlow ConfigsConfigConfigGuided chat coaching topressure-test branch signals,spot dirty data...Trigger: inputDefines the graph defaultsIStartInputInputInputWhatsApp entry pointNew conversations begin hereKBKnowledge base firstKnowledge BotResponseResponseHelp the user make a decisionwith messy branch signals. Be…Mode: defaultFallback enabledIMChoose a decision…Interactive MessageResponseResponsePick what you’re trying todecide. I’ll help youpressure-test the signal…6 options • Audit branch KPI •Dirty signal checkTip: run two checks if the number…IFIf: Audit branch KPIIFLogicLogicaudit_branch_number...TRUE -> next FALSE -> waitIFIf: Dirty signal checkIFLogicLogicspot_dirty_signal =TRUE -> next FALSE -> waitIFIf: Auto vs humanIFLogicLogicautomation_vs_judgm...TRUE -> next FALSE -> waitIFIf: Compare branchesIFLogicLogiccompare_branches =TRUE -> next FALSE -> waitIFIf: Signal cultureIFLogicLogicbuild_signal_cultur...TRUE -> next FALSE -> waitIFIf: Human helpIFLogicLogictalk_to_human =TRUE -> next FALSE -> waitTCoach: Trustworthy vs…Simple MessageResponseResponseAudit the number before youadopt it. **Numbers thatdeserve trust (usually):** 1)…985 charsTCoach: Dirty signal…Simple MessageResponseResponseDirty signal rarely announcesitself. It shows up asconfidence. **Early warning…922 charsTCoach: When to trust…Simple MessageResponseResponseAutomation is great atrepeating a rule. It’s terribleat noticing the rule no longer…866 charsTCoach: Comparing…Simple MessageResponseResponseBranch comparisons go wrong inpredictable ways—mainly becausethe world isn’t evenly…820 charsTCoach: Build a signal…Simple MessageResponseResponseA good signal culture doesn’tworship data. It uses data tomake decisions faster—and…746 charsFHHandoff to teamMessenger HandoffHandoffHandoffOps AnalyticsGot it. I’m routing you to ateammate for a deeper look. If…Routes the conversation to a…TNo menu match (round…Simple MessageResponseResponseI didn’t catch a menuselection. Tap one of thebuttons so I can route you to…156 charsIMRun another check?Interactive MessageResponseResponseIf this decision matters, asecond check usually finds whatthe first one missed.2 options • Yes—another •No—doneYou can also ask for human help…IFIf: Yes—anotherIFLogicLogicanother_yes =TRUE -> next FALSE -> waitIMChoose another checkInteractive MessageResponseResponseSame menu, one more time.Choose the check that wouldmost change your mind if it...6 options • Audit branch KPI •Dirty signal checkThen I’ll wrap up with next steps.IFIf: Audit branch KPI…IFLogicLogicaudit_branch_number...TRUE -> next FALSE -> waitIFIf: Dirty signal chec…IFLogicLogicspot_dirty_signal_2...TRUE -> next FALSE -> waitIFIf: Auto vs human (2)IFLogicLogicautomation_vs_judgm...TRUE -> next FALSE -> waitIFIf: Compare branches…IFLogicLogiccompare_branches_2 =TRUE -> next FALSE -> waitIFIf: Signal culture (2)IFLogicLogicbuild_signal_cultur...TRUE -> next FALSE -> waitIFIf: Human help (2)IFLogicLogictalk_to_human_2 =TRUE -> next FALSE -> waitTCoach: Trustworthy vs…Simple MessageResponseResponseSecond pass: audit the numberlike it’s trying to fool you(because sometimes it is).…551 charsTCoach: Dirty signal…Simple MessageResponseResponseSecond pass: dirty signalcheck. **Quick tells:** -Effects appear before causes…395 charsTCoach: When to trust…Simple MessageResponseResponseSecond pass: automationguardrails. **Automate when:**reversible + stable definition…311 charsTCoach: Comparing…Simple MessageResponseResponseSecond pass: branch comparisoncheck. **Fair comparisonbasics:** - Normalize for…313 charsTCoach: Build a signal…Simple MessageResponseResponseSecond pass: signal culturethat produces decisions. **Keepit lightweight:** - Metric…310 charsTNo menu match (round…Simple MessageResponseResponseI didn’t catch that selection.If you need a deeper look,choose **Human help**—or share…130 charsTCloseSimple MessageResponseResponseGood. Your job isn’t to makethe numbers pretty—it’s to makethe decision safe. If you want…229 chars

Use the JSON view if you need to inspect or copy the exact structure.

Workflow guide

A practical operator-friendly explanation of how this automation works.

4 sections

How it works

This workflow turns "We have numbers—can we trust them?" into a fast, decision-shaped conversation. It starts with a knowledge-base policy so common questions get answered consistently, then routes the user through a menu of practical checks (trustworthy branch metrics, dirty-signal detection, automation vs judgment, and comparison pitfalls).

The goal isn’t to over-clean the evidence until it lies politely. It’s to help a leader catch the usual failure modes before the confident meeting, the tidy dashboard, and the wrong decision all shake hands.

Key features

  • Knowledge-base-first behavior for consistent answers, with routing into a guided decision menu when needed.
  • Button-driven triage across the most common signal failures: polished noise, dirty data, attribution traps, and branch comparisons.
  • Practical “what to check next” responses designed for leaders—not analysts.
  • Built-in loop back to the menu so users can run multiple checks in one session.
  • Optional human handoff path for cases that shouldn’t be automated.

Step-by-step

  1. Trigger: A user starts the conversation (Input).
  2. Knowledge Base Policy: The assistant answers from your Knowledge Base when it can; otherwise it proceeds to the decision menu.
  3. Decision menu (buttons): The user chooses one path:
    1. Audit a branch number → receives a checklist to separate reliable metrics from polished noise.
    2. Spot dirty signal early → receives warning signs and fast “sanity tests” to run before a meeting.
    3. Automation vs judgment → receives decision rules for when automation is safe and when humans must override.
    4. Compare branches fairly → receives common comparison traps and how to compare without fooling yourself.
    5. Build a signal culture → receives lightweight operating habits that produce decisions, not slides.
    6. Talk to a human → routes to a handoff message.
  4. Loop: After each coaching response (except handoff), the workflow returns the user to the decision menu to run another check.

Setup requirements

  • Calypso Knowledge Base (optional but recommended): Populate with your organization’s definitions (branch KPIs, attribution rules, data sources, known data-quality issues). No additional credentials are required beyond your Calypso setup.
  • Channel: Connect a chat channel that supports interactive buttons (for example, WhatsApp).

Ready to use this workflow?

Import this workflow into your Calypso account and start automating your processes.

Go to Calypso